    NOTICE: Valid Development Permit Required For Land Development

    Planning to build or develop land in Antigua & Barbuda?

    No matter what other laws or approvals you may have, you CANNOT start any land development without a valid development permit issued under the law.

    • Building a house

    • Subdividing land

    • Commercial development

    A development permit is mandatory. Starting work without one is illegal, even if you believe another approval covers you.

    Before you break ground, make sure your permit is in place. It saves time, money, and serious legal trouble. When in doubt, always check with the relevant planning authority.
